  • Top Greek Chefs Elevate Island Cuisine

    The trend of famous Greek Chefs signing the menus in restaurants and hotels of favorite islands and popular summer destinations grows stronger year by year. Lefteris Lazarou (“Varoulko Seaside”) begins to have dealings with Ios and Kea this year. In Kea, he sets his seal on the restaurant of the “Porto Kea Suites”, as he is responsible for the overall taste aspect of the menu.
